Understanding the Purpose of the JAMB Registration Template

JAMB Registration Template is not the final registration document. It is simply a guide that mirrors the real online form candidates will fill out at an accredited centre.

JAMB Registration Template is provided every year for free so that candidates can:

  • Understand the type of information needed for registration
  • Carefully take their time to fill in their choices before going to a CBT centre
  • Avoid errors such as wrong subject combinations, incorrect personal details, or mistaken institution choices
  • Consult parents, mentors, or teachers before finalising any selection
  • Speed up the registration process at the CBT centre

Many candidates wrongly assume they can pay to collect the template or even submit it to the CBT centre. This is not true.

JAMB Registration Template is free. You must never pay for it. And it must not be submitted at the centre.

You only take the template with you to guide your official registration.

Important Warning to All Candidates

Some cybercafés try to exploit ignorant candidates by charging them for the JAMB Registration Template. Do not fall for this.

JAMB has clearly stated:

“DO NOT PAY for this template, and DO NOT SUBMIT it at the registration centre. It is only a guide.”

If you decide to print it at a café, you will pay only for the printing service, not the template itself, it remains free.

Colour printing is not required. A simple black-and-white printout is perfectly fine.

Registration Timeline for the 2026 UTME

The official registration window for the 2026 UTME is: January 26th – February 28th, 2026

This registration period gives candidates more than four weeks to prepare, finalise their choices, and complete the process without rushing.

What the JAMB Registration Template Contains

Although you are not required to submit the JAMB Registration Template, it mirrors everything that will appear on the official online registration form. It includes fields for:

  • Personal details
  • Contact information
  • Nationality and state information
  • O’level details
  • Course of choice
  • Institution choices
  • UTME subject combinations
  • Preferred exam town
  • Disability status (if applicable)
  • JAMB’s newly introduced mandatory fields

By completing everything on paper before heading to the CBT centre, you ensure that nothing is missed out or wrongly entered.

Why Accuracy Is Extremely Important

Incorrect details cause major problems in the future. Here are examples:

Name Errors

If your name on JAMB differs from what is on your WAEC/NECO/NIN records, you may face challenges during admission and clearance.

Wrong Email

You will miss out on notifications, admission messages, or password resets.

Wrong Subject Combinations

You may not be considered for admission even if you score high.

Incorrect Course or Institution

You may regret a rushed choice later. This is why the JAMB Registration Template encourages calm and deliberate decision-making.

How to Properly Use the JAMB Registration Template

Here is a simple guide on how to use the JAMB Registration Template:

1. Download the 2026 JAMB Registration Template: Get the document from a reliable source. JAMB releases it publicly, and it remains free.

2. Print the Template: Print in black and white to reduce cost. You only pay for printing, not the template itself.

3. Sit Down and Fill Every Section Carefully: Do not rush. Take your time. If you’re unsure about any field, mark it and return to it later after getting guidance.

4. Consult Trusted Experts: Go through the form with a parent, elder sibling, teacher, counsellor, or mentor. Their advice can help shape your decisions, especially regarding:

  • Institutions
  • Courses
  • Subject combinations
  • Alternative choices
  • Competitive programmes
  1. Review Your Entries

Check again for:

  • Spelling errors
  • Wrong dates
  • Incorrect numbers
  • Incomplete fields
  1. Take the Completed Template With You to the CBT Centre: This will help the operator input everything accurately and quickly.
